Indianapolis Colts head coach Shane Steichen announced that Anthony Richardson will regain starting quarterback duties for the team, beginning with this weekend’s game against the New York Jets. Richardson’s improved practice performance led to him reclaiming the starting role for the remainder of the season, despite Joe Flacco starting the past two games. Flacco’s struggles did not factor into the decision, as the Colts look to improve their 4-6 record and make a push for the AFC playoffs.
